On Tue, 2008-02-05 at 21:51 +0100, Sven Wegener wrote:
WRAP systems have an additional LED. The power LED is normally lit after boot
and doesn't serve any other purpose besides showing that the system is powered
on. Nevertheless, its state is controllable and we can attach a trigger to it.
There is already a patch queued up to do something like this in the LED
tree, can you check that does everything you need please?
